尚硅谷2020最新版SpringCloud(H版&alibaba)框架开发教程学习 Spring Cloud升级组件后的技术选型(仅供参考)

Spring Cloud升级组件后的选型

一. 注册中心选型

1. Eureka–不再更新新版本,不推荐

2. zookeper

3. consul

4. Nacos–推荐使用

二. 服务调用

1. Ribbon–有些问题了

2. LoadBalancer–刚起步

3. Feign–不再维护,不推荐

4. OpenFeign–可以考虑

三. 服务降级

1. Hystrix–官网已不再推荐,国内刚开始使用

2. Resilience4j --官网目前推荐

Resilience4j 是受Netflix的Hysrix项目启发,专门为Java 8 和函数式编程设计的轻量级容错框架。轻量级体现在其只用 Vavr 库(前身是 Javaslang),没有任何外部依赖。而 Hystrix 依赖了 Archaius ,Archaius 本身又依赖很多第三方包,例如 Guava、Apache Commons Configuration 等。

3. Sentinel–阿里出品,强烈推荐

四. 服务网关

1. Zuul–不推荐了

2. Zuul2-- 有问题

3. GateWay–官网推荐

五. 服务配置

1. config–不推荐

2. Nacos–推荐

六. 服务总线

1. BUS–不推荐了

2. Nacos–推荐

发布了11 篇原创文章 · 获赞 7 · 访问量 1万+

猜你喜欢

转载自blog.csdn.net/foundtime/article/details/105539096